There have been challenges for those in the real estate industry for the last few months! And yet buyers are buying, sellers are selling, and agents are closing deals. Home inspections, appraisals, termite, well yields, septic inspections, surveys, and the title work is all getting done. Negotiations are taking place. We are busy, and our industry is moving forward. We are doing buyer consultations and listing presentations, and we are doing them safely.
We have the technology already. Now we have to make better use of it.
Today I did an open house by going early and unlocking the property, opened all doors including closets and turned on ceiling fans, lights and made sure the temperature gauge was cool enough. Signage on my car, on the street, and an announcement on ALL ABOUT REAL ESTATE, my Sunday live real estate radio show.
I was prepared with individual plastic bags with a mask, gloves, and my card, ready to give out. The agents and the buyers all came with their supplies.
What did I do?
I stayed outside on this lovely sunny day, in the shade, and was able to guide prospective buyers and answer all questions. It's not quite as easy talking, masked, at a distance.
But we are getting it all done.
